Among those raw material prices used in construction which have undergone the highest rates of inflation over the last twelve months are: Electric energy (22.9%), Asphalt products (18.5%), Oil by-products (12.3%), Iron and steel (13.2%) and Explosives and gases (7.3%). On the other hand, there were price falls or low increases in the inter-annual prices (July 2006 on July 2005) of the raw materials used in Ceramic products (-0.1%), Stone masonry (0.0%), Wood and cork (0.7%) and Paint and varnish (0.8%).
